World Journal Tribune TV Magazine, Jan. 29, 1967


How three orphans can steal CBS series

In Family Affair, it's the kids who steal the show. Anissa Jones as Buffy and John (sic) Whitaker as Jody were supposed to be supporting characters for stars Brian Keith and Sebastian Cabot when the CBS Monday night comedy series went on the air in the fall.

Cabot has been ill and out of the cast for a while (he's due back in March), and English actor John Williams has been his substitute. But the kids and Kathy Garver, as the teen-ager, Cissy, have held on to the strong ratings.

Kathy, 18, is a TV veteran of many shows, including Ben Casey and Dr. Kildare. She's majoring in speech at UCLA. Anissa, 8, and John, 7, portray twins, but she is the daughter of a Purdue University professor and he is one of seven children of Mr. and Mrs. John Orson Whitaker, of Van Nuys, Calif.

Everyone seems to agree that it's the warmth projected by these youngsters that makes the show go.
